about

An old song from the 1980s that still feels new, especially after re-imagining it together, although the glaciers might be a lot longer in coming than Cindy had envisioned then. The song was first recorded on Cindy’s second Folk-Legacy album, "Cindy Kallet 2."

credits

from Welcome Day, released September 15, 2015
Cindy Kallet: vocal, guitar
Grey Larsen: harmonium, Irish flute, Irish alto flute
Words and music by Cindy Kallet, BMI
Produced by Grey Larsen and Cindy Kallet
Recorded and mixed by Grey Larsen at Sleepy Creek Recording, Bloomington, Indiana USA
Mastered by Grey Larsen at Grey Larsen Mastering, Bloomington, Indiana USA
Mixing and mastering consultation by Mark Hood
Photographs by Alison Shaw
Graphic Design by Marty Somberg
